Transaction 9f91cf7420fbf46b28eb0890acc732995496e074b3223126d33180111e9c6e75

1 Input
2 Outputs
  • 9f91cf7420fbf46b28eb0890acc732995496e074b3223126d33180111e9c6e75:0
  • value  31590000
    address  3QQH93X9629gvHQ6j5V5435WtwWerGzuGr
  • 9f91cf7420fbf46b28eb0890acc732995496e074b3223126d33180111e9c6e75:1
  • value  392470656
    address  1FW8jdid3XbKMb3wFA8DcQqyiciSMhZi8b